- Lybius minor
Identification
Red frons, white underparts with pinkish wash on belly and black thighs are diagnostic.
Distribution
Africa: Gabon, Republic of the Congo, Democratic Republic of Congo, Angola, Burundi, Tanzania, Zambia, Malawi.
Taxonomy
Some authorities split this taxon into two species:
- L. minor; and
- L. macclounii (Mcclouni's Barbet).
